100-140 for steeda. 130-170 for B&M (B&M usually includes a new knob, for the steeda its like 30 more i believe) all depends on where ya go and who has deals, if you can find it on ebay...etc.
The throws are about the same. So you can actualy base it on, if you want your new shifters height 1" below stock or 3" below stock. (1" steeda; 3" B&M)

The main difference between a cut stocker and the B&M is the overall feel of the shifter. The cut stock shifter still has that soft, spongy feel, where the B&M has very solid, firm shifts. Cutting the stock shifter is a waste of the 10 minutes it takes to do it IMO.

I have taken pics of the stock shifter and the Steeda I bought prior to instaling. There is a noticable difference in the shaft length BELOW the pivit point (the ball). This is what creates the shorter throw. It's simple physics.
Now the B&M we all know is shorter then stock and the Steeda however the part that matters most when it comes to throw length is the shaft length below the ball and the B&M is the same as stock. So again it's rules of physics.
As far as the B&M, the more solid shifts (over the spongey stock shifts) may create the illusion of shorter/quicker shifts. All I know is I contemplated both and went WITH physics.
Now I got the Steeda w/ shift nob for $175 which is about the same as the B&M. It's your $.
Personally, as stated, I would get the Steeda and cut the length of the shaft for the overall best shifter.
